To check my engine monitor I need to rig up a temporary oil temperature guage. I would just like to purchase one of the automotive guages for this purpose and I was wondering if any one knows what the standard thread is for the Lycoming installation. Also any leads on a guage that would work for this temporary installation please let me know. Thanks in advance

I'd bet you at least .02 that it's a 5/8"-18 thread. ::p

You know if you want to test the accuracy of your monitor, you might just put the probe into boiling water. Look for 212 deg F. :)
